I can't believe more people aren't complanining about this company. I ordered a Xantech controller, and needed it very badly. Tried to contact them by email and the email bounced back. Then I got an email stating that this was a rare item, and would ship within 14 days. Cancellation would result in a 25% restocking fee! How's that - a restock fee for an out-of-stock item. It has now been 19 days. Getting nervous, especially since I haven't been able to contact them, this is what I found:
* Terms and conditions states they can charge my credit card anytime they want for up to 36 MONTHS!
* Phone number listed on website is for a New York Law firm.
* New York address on website is for a window cleaning service (google).
* Another person reviewing this site noted a different New York address. That one is for a Salon.
* aboutus.com lists a registration phone number for BrandNamez.com w/ 305 area code. It is a medical supply company
* WhoIs.com is usually the best resource for finding the website owner. Whois message stated that the website was not internet compliant, and would not access the data. NEVER SEEN THAT HAPPEN BEFORE.
Who are these guys? I don't understand why there aren't any alarms going off. I cancelled my credit card - that's right - I'm that worried.
